- 拉代码,默认拉下来的是master分支
git clone 仓库地址
2.拉下来的是分支代码
git clone -b 分支名
3.git checkout -b branch 创建并切换分支
git checkout branch 切换分支
4.git -b branch 创建分支
5.git branch查看分支
6.git branch -d branch删除本地分支(需要先切换到别的分支)
git push origin --delete branch删除远程分支
7.git branch -D branch 强制删除本地分支
8.git branch -vv查看当前分支详细信息
9.git remote -vv查看当前远程仓库信息
10.git push origin 本地分支:远程分支 建立本地分支和远程分支的追踪关系
本地分支与远程分支关联,这样git push就可以直接推送到远程关联分支,否则每次都要完整输入远程分支名
git branch --set-upstream debug origin/debug
11.git add file提交到暂存区,git commit -m 'comments'提交到本地仓库,git push 提交到远程仓库
git commit -am=git add+git commit
12.撤销本地修改,未暂存区回退到文件初始状态
git checkout -- filename(此处filename一定要带上路径)
13.暂存区回退到文件初始状态
- git checkout head – files
14.查看提交记录
git log
查看最后一次提交记录
git log -n 1